Description
Electrofusion fittings, such as the Transition Coupling - Female, are essential components designed for the reliable joining of polyethylene piping systems through controlled fusion welding. These fittings create permanent, leak-free joints that enhance the safety and reliability of various applications, including water reticulation systems, gas distribution networks, mining infrastructure, and industrial fluid transfer installations. The use of electrofusion technology ensures consistent joint quality while significantly reducing the risk of leakage.
